> I have even tried
> deleting that section from the newuser.js
newuser.js is not used by any web interface.
And what "section" are you referring to? There's nothing in the stock newuser.js about prompting for a netmail address.
> and it still requires the netmail
> address before completing the registration.
If you're refering to ecWebv4, then the file that controls that is webv4/pages/000-register.xjs. And looking at the code, it seems to only require the netmail field if its so-configured in SCFG (the checks for UQ_NONETMAIL).
